Rumah> pangkalan data> Oracle> teks badan

oracle字段长度怎么修改

PHPz
Lepaskan: 2023-04-17 15:13:33
asal
6727 orang telah melayarinya

Oracle是一款常用的关系型数据库管理系统,它广泛应用于企业级系统中。在日常的开发中,我们会遇到需要调整Oracle数据表中字段长度的情况。本篇文章将从以下五个方面介绍如何修改Oracle字段长度。

一、了解Oracle字段类型

在修改Oracle字段长度之前,我们需要了解Oracle字段类型。Oracle支持多种字段类型,包括数值型、字符型、日期型等。在确定要修改的字段时,我们需要清楚它的数据类型。

二、备份数据表

在修改Oracle字段长度时,为了避免数据丢失,我们需要在修改之前备份数据表。可以使用备份工具对整个数据表进行备份,也可以备份特定的数据字段。

三、修改字段长度

在备份数据表之后,我们可以开始修改字段长度。Oracle提供了修改字段长度的命令“ALTER TABLE table_name MODIFY (column_name datatype(size));”,其中table_name是要修改的数据表名,column_name是要修改的字段名,datatype是字段数据类型,size是字段长度。

例如,我们要将user表的username字段从VARCHAR2(50)修改为VARCHAR2(100),可以使用以下命令:

ALTER TABLE user MODIFY (username VARCHAR2(100));

四、验证修改结果

在修改完Oracle字段长度后,我们需要验证修改结果是否符合预期。可以使用SQL查询语句对修改后的字段进行查询,比如使用“SELECT column_name FROM table_name;”查询字段数据。

例如,使用如下SQL语句查询user表的username字段:

SELECT username FROM user;

五、测试数据记录

修改完Oracle字段长度后,我们需要对已有数据进行测试,以确保修改对已有数据没有影响,数据可以正常进行读取和写入。

在测试数据记录时,我们可以使用一些数据抽样技术,比如随机选择一部分数据进行读写操作,验证数据是否能够正常保存。

总结

本文介绍了如何修改Oracle字段长度,需要注意备份数据、了解字段类型、验证修改结果以及测试数据记录等方面。当对Oracle数据表字段长度需要进行修改时,遵循以上步骤可以有效减少数据丢失、数据格式混乱等风险,保证系统正常运行。

Atas ialah kandungan terperinci oracle字段长度怎么修改.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

sumber:php.cn
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an
Tentang kita Penafian Sitemap
Laman web PHP Cina:Latihan PHP dalam talian kebajikan awam,Bantu pelajar PHP berkembang dengan cepat!